
THE Chinese giant BYD continues its rapid rise. Already a leading manufacturer in its country, the company ” Build your dreams » recently exceeded Ford in the world ranking last November.
But the company now 5th place in the world car manufacturers, goes even further and reveals its ambitions regarding sea transport on a large scale. The ability to internalize a link in the supply chain to better serve its customers worldwide.
BYD cargo ships behind self-made batteries!
The Chinese manufacturer has an ambitious strategy expand your exports to other markets. Where most car companies use specialized transport companies to deliver their vehicles, BYD wants to do things differently and not depend on a third party.
Only one solution remains possible: have their own fleet of cargo ships. And this is what BYD has just started to do!
BYD’s first cargo ship, capable of transporting 7,000 vehicles, sets sail
Launch of EXPLORER NO. 1 further strengthens BYD’s vertical integration and position as the global leader in NEV production. In 2023, BYD exported 242,765 NEVs, up 334.2% from last year.

A fleet of seven freighters within two years
In a post on the social network Explore number 1. There was a cargo ship launched on January 10 the latter is already making its maiden voyage from Xiaomi’s logistics port in Shenzhen.
Measures Explorer #1 199.9 meters for a long time and maybe accommodates up to 7,000 cars. It also features a powertrain that combines conventional fuel and liquefied natural gas to reduce the vehicle’s environmental impact.
Gradually brand will add up to seven cargo ships to its fleet in order to better control the distribution of its vehicles and thus reduce its dependence on third-party carriers.
Soon in the TOP-3 in the world?
BYD for export 242,765 cars recharges in 2023, i.e. growth 334.2% compared to the previous year. She sold 3.02 million electric vehicles all over the world, in particular in China, country of origin, where it is the undisputed sales leader.
BYD is now represented in more than 70 countries, and already sells five cars in France. The newest model to date, which will soon be tested on our site: the BYD Seal U SUVdirect competitor in Tesla Model Y.
